Former imperial palace rebuilt after a fire destroyed most of its two-century collection.

This guide to Brazil's National Museum in Rio starts with two fire hydrants outside the building that produced no water when firefighters needed them, during the fire that tore through this nineteenth-century palace on September 2, 2018. It traces the museum's earlier life as a merchant's country house built around 1803, gifted to the Portuguese prince regent and later opened as the National Museum in 1892, plus the budget cuts that left it unprotected in the years before the fire. The museum's own director later spoke about that shortfall with unusual bluntness.
